#12 · (Edited)
Best I can tell on mine is they come off the backup lamp switch on the passenger side of the transmission into a small harness plug into a larger plug then into a small wire loom that runs up past the starter...I lost them in a clump of loom right next to the main ground stud on the block. I would assume from there runs along the firewall to the bulkhead connector and through the fuse block then out to the backup lamps in the loom that runs along the driver's side inside the tub. Check the wiring diagrams to confirm that.
